My Magicjack needed to be replaced. Last night it started not allowing the digits to be dialed from the handset phone (everything else worked including making calls with the softphone and receiving calls on the handset and the softphone). I tried the usual restarting of everything, and even installed the jack on a brand new computer. The same problem persisted. I tried using different handset phones, the problem persisted. It took me over two hours in their "chat" customer service, to get a replacement.
everyone should be aware of the lengths this company has trained its customer service people to go to in order to avoid sending out a replacement jack. Two hours of my time eats up the savings I accrue with Magic Jack over my other providers, as would paying for a replacement jack. The information I gave them in the first 5 minutes was sufficient for a technician to gauge that the the jack needed replacing, but they kept me on for 2 hours doing pointless and repetitive tests. I still think magic jack is a good product, but don't expect their customer service to treat you like a real customer and listen, they just go straight to their checklist then pass you up to a higher level when everything they are TOLD to test does not solve the problem. This is a pattern of customer service indicates to me that their reps do not have real technical skills, and may not even be using Magic Jack themselves.
